    Ange (pronounced in a French way) runs Ceroc in NZ. And she is based in Auckland.

    There's dancing in the centre of Auckland, at a studio set aside for Ceroc in Lorne St. It's pretty easy to get to, and runs just behind the main street in the centre.

    There's also dancing all around the outskirts of Auckland, and you can pick that up from the website.

    Adam actually runs Ceroc in Wellington, right down the bottom of the North Island. It's well worth a trip down there.

    As The Tramp mentioned Lorne Street is in the centre of town and easy to get to from practically anywhere. They have classes and freestyle four times a week so there are plenty of chances to go there. Sundays have a much more chilled vibe with the music than the other days. There are smaller ceroc classes pretty much all over the suburban Auckland area, run out of school and community halls much like in the UK.

    The LeBop places are all in the central suburbs but if you're relying on public transport they'll be harder to get to unless you happen to be staying close to them. The one on Ponsonby road is almost certainly the easiest to get to by bus since a cheap and regular bus service runs right past it from the centre of town (it's called the Link).
